Roku reports earnings after market close, meaning Day 0 reflects anticipatory trading before results are released, while Day +1 captures the market's first full session to react to actual results.
| Earnings Date | Day 0 Move | Day 0 Range | Day +1 Move | Day +1 Range |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2026-04-30 | +$3.94 (+3.50%) | $8.18 (7.26%) | +$7.02 (+6.02%) | $12.00 (10.30%) |
| 2026-02-12 | -$4.96 (-5.64%) | $10.60 (12.06%) | +$7.13 (+8.60%) | $9.97 (12.02%) |
| 2025-10-30 | +$1.42 (+1.44%) | $6.09 (6.18%) | +$6.10 (+6.10%) | $19.89 (19.88%) |
| 2025-07-31 | +$2.16 (+2.35%) | $2.87 (3.12%) | -$14.18 (-15.06%) | $6.41 (6.81%) |
| 2025-05-01 | -$0.91 (-1.33%) | $4.32 (6.34%) | -$5.72 (-8.50%) | $5.13 (7.62%) |
| 2025-02-13 | +$2.02 (+2.38%) | $5.67 (6.69%) | +$12.27 (+14.14%) | $8.80 (10.14%) |
| 2024-10-30 | +$1.10 (+1.44%) | $3.21 (4.20%) | -$13.43 (-17.33%) | $8.70 (11.22%) |
| 2024-08-01 | -$2.88 (-4.95%) | $4.32 (7.42%) | -$2.19 (-3.96%) | $5.03 (9.09%) |
| Avg Abs Move | 2.88% | 6.66% | 9.96% | 10.89% |
Roku has demonstrated significant post-earnings volatility with a strong positive bias in recent quarters. The stock has posted positive Day +1 moves in three consecutive reports: +6.02% following the April 2026 report, +8.60% after February 2026, and +6.10% following October 2025. This recent winning streak contrasts with more mixed performance earlier in the historical period.
The average absolute Day 0 move of 2.88% is relatively modest, reflecting limited anticipatory trading before results drop. However, the Day +1 average of 9.96% shows substantial reaction once actual results are digested, with the Day +1 range averaging 10.89%, indicating considerable intraday volatility as the market processes the information. The largest recent move came in February 2025 when the stock surged +14.14% on Day +1, while the most significant decline occurred in October 2024 with a -17.33% Day +1 drop. Investors should prepare for meaningful price movement following this release, particularly given the stock's recent pattern of strong positive reactions to earnings beats.

The options market is pricing in a 3.74% expected move for this earnings release, which is substantially below the stock's 9.96% average absolute Day +1 move over the last eight quarters. This suggests options traders may be underpricing the potential volatility, particularly given Roku's recent pattern of significant positive reactions to earnings beats.
Wall Street maintains a cautiously optimistic stance on Roku with an average analyst rating of 3.69 (between Hold and Buy) and a mean price target of $155.50, implying approximately 5.8% upside from the current price of $146.96. The consensus reflects measured enthusiasm rather than overwhelming bullish conviction, with price targets ranging from a low of $126.00 to a high of $175.00.
The rating breakdown shows 11 analysts with buy or strong buy ratings (9 strong buys and 2 moderate buys), while 18 analysts maintain hold recommendations. Notably, there are no sell ratings among the 29 analysts covering the stock, suggesting the Street sees limited downside risk even as some remain cautious about the valuation following the stock's 35.5% year-to-date gain.
Analyst sentiment has remained unchanged over the past month, with the distribution of ratings holding steady at 9 strong buys, 2 moderate buys, and 18 holds. This stability suggests analysts are waiting for the Q2 results to provide fresh catalysts for potential upgrades, particularly as the company works to prove it can sustain its profitability trajectory. The concentration of hold ratings despite strong recent performance indicates many analysts view the stock as fairly valued at current levels and want to see continued execution before becoming more aggressive with their recommendations.
